Recently science-artist Willy Chyr [@willychyr] was looking for a Twitter list of #sciart to follow, and turned to ours. Admittedly, this was set-up in the early days of our blog and hasn't been kept up to date. So we've been working on it!
So far featuring over 200 science-artists, please let us know if you'd like to be added or if we have missed someone.

What is #sciart?

It's the most commonly used hashtag on Twitter and Google+ for imagery involved-in or inspired-by science, or the science behind imagery. Like what we bring you here on Symbiartic!
